Peripheral Nerve and Muscle 329 Peripheral Neuropathies Peripheral Nerve Injuries Peripheral nerves may be briefly or permanently damaged by strain, transection, crushes, blows, or traction. Pathogenesis Local nerve compression displaces the axoplasm laterally from the site of compression. This causes invagination and subsequent demyelination at the nodes of Ranvier, so that saltatory impulse conduction is blocked. Schwann cells and axon processes regenerate within the damaged region and distally alongside the intact enveloping constructions until they reach the effector muscle. Nerve transection is adopted by axonal and Schwann cell proliferation, which can result in the formation of a neuroma at the proximal nerve stump. Suturing the proximal and distal stumps together allows the regenerating fibers to enter the distal enveloping constructions and regenerate additional, however the operate of the nerve is usually not totally restored to its authentic state. Porphyria Among the recognized porphyrias, 4 hepatic types are associated with encephalopathy and peripheral neuropathy: variegate porphyria, acute intermittent porphyria, hereditary coproporphyria, and -aminolevulinic acid dehydrase deficiency (autosomal recessive; the others are autosomal dominant). Severe peripheral neuropathy is seen throughout assaults of acute porphyria, that are most frequently precipitated by medicines and hormonal influences (also fasting, alcohol, and infection). The manifestations of porphyria embody colicky abdominal ache, ache within the limbs, paresthesiae, tachycardia, and variable levels of weak point. Encephalopathy is manifest as confusion, lack of focus, somnolence, psychosis, hallucinations and/or epileptic seizures. The analysis of porphyria relies on the demonstration of porphyrin metabolites within the urine and feces. Alpha Rhythm: Human Versus Animal the posterior alpha rhythm exhibits considerabledifference from species to species. The alpha frequency usually lies above 10/secin primates, and the amplitude is surprisingly small in primates (recorded from dural electrodes). In the cat, an 8-13/sec rhythm was recorded from the most posterior a part of} the occipital cortex (Lanoir, 1972). Pampiglione (1963) demonstrated a reasonably well developed posterior 6-8/sec rhythm within the dog at 1 year of age. This rhythm representsan equal of the human alpha rhythm (Storrn van Leeuwen et al. Jurko and Andy (1967) in contrast the posterior alpha rhythm in three speciesof macaquemonkeys. In rhesus(Macaca mulatta) and stumptnl (Rhesus speciosa) monkeys, pretty well-developed alpha rhythms, 10/secand 12lsec, respectively, had been recorded, whereas greater admixture of gradual and fast frequencies was present in cynomolgus monkeys (Macaca ira). The closest resemblanceto the human alpha is found within the dog (Storm van Leeuwen et al. Spine the spine (vertebral column) bears the burden of the pinnacle, neck, trunk and upper extremities. Its flexibility is biggest in the cervical area, intermediate in the lumbar area, and lowest in the thoracic area. Its uppermost vertebrae (atlas and axis) articulate with the pinnacle, and its lowermost portion, the sacrum (which consists of 5 vertebrae fused together), articulates with the pelvis. There are 7 cervical, 12 thoracic (in British usage dorsal), and 5 lumbar vertebrae, making a complete of 24 above the sacrum. Spinal Cord Like the brain, the spinal twine is intimately enveloped by the pia mater, which incorporates quite a few nerves and blood vessels; the pia mater merges with the endoneurium of the spinal nerve rootlets and in addition continues below the spinal twine as the filum terminale internum. The weblike spinal arachnoid membrane incorporates only a few capillaries and no nerves. The denticulate ligament runs between the pia mater and the dura mater and anchors the spinal twine to the dura mater. In lumbar puncture, cerebrospinal fluid is withdrawn from the house between the arachnoid membrane and pia mater (spinal subarachnoid space), which communicates with the subarachnoid house of the brain. The spinal dura mater originates on the fringe of the foramen magnum and descends from it to form a tubular overlaying across the spinal twine. Its lumen ends on the S1�S2 degree, the place it continues as the filum terminale externum, which attaches to the sacrum, thus anchoring the dura mater inferiorly. The dura mater varieties sleeves across the anterior and posterior spinal nerve roots which proceed distally, along with the arachnoid membrane, to form the epineurium and perineurium of the spinal nerves. The root filaments (rootlets) that come together to form the ventral and dorsal spinal nerve roots are organized in longitudinal rows on the lateral surface of the spinal twine on either side. The ventral root carries only motor fibers, while the dorsal root carries only sensory fibers. Spine and Spinal Cord 30 Intervertebral Disks Each pair of adjoining vertebrae is separated by an intervertebral disk. From the third decade of life onward, each disk progressively diminishes in water content material, and therefore also in peak. Its tensile, fibrous outer ring (annulus fibrosus) connects it with the vertebrae above and below and is held taut by the pressure in the central nucleus pulposus, which varies as a function of the momentary place of the body. The pressure that obtains in the sitting place is double the pressure when the affected person stands, but that discovered in the recumbent place is only onethird as great. The interior of the disk has no nociceptive innervation, in distinction to the periosteum of the vertebral bodies, which is innervated by the meningeal branch of the segmental spinal nerve, as are the intervertebral joint capsules, the posterior longitudinal ligament, the dorsal portion of the annulus fibrosus, the dura mater, and the blood vessels. The motor system can be divided into the pyramidal system and the extrapyramidal system. The pyramidal system includes the corticospinal tracts that span the brain, brainstem, and spinal cord to talk with the peripheral nervous system. The extrapyramidal system includes the basal ganglia and cerebellum, which serve to initiate, pattern, and coordinate movements. Lesions within the pyramidal system produce weak point, lesions within the cerebellum can produce impaired coordination of movements (ataxia and dysmetria), and lesions within the basal ganglia can alter muscle tone (rigidity) and trigger pathologically decreased or increased motion (see "Disorders Presenting with Abnormal Movements"). Lesions affecting higher-level motor cortices impair the power to perform advanced learned motor duties (apraxia). The pyramidal system has 2 major components: higher motor neurons within the central nervous system and decrease motor neurons whose axons lie within the peripheral nervous system. The higher motor neurons start within the precentral gyrus of the frontal lobe and travel within the corticospinal tracts via the subcortical white matter and anterior brainstem, crossing on the cervicomedullary junction to descend within the contralateral spinal cord. The axons of the corticospinal tracts synapse on decrease motor neurons within the anterior horn of the spinal cord. These decrease motor neurons travel via ventral roots into peripheral nerves and terminate at neuromuscular junctions to stimulate muscle contraction. Considerations this affected person has brief (<30 sec) episodes of vertigo which are be} introduced out by place modifications. This dysfunction is brought on by otoliths (calcium stones) which have congregated inside the posterior semicircular canal and that transfer like a piston in response to place modifications. The therapy involves shifting the affected person, and by extension the misplaced otoliths, by way of a collection of maneuvers that can place the otoliths again into the otolith organs. Failing this maneuver, different therapies use a strategy that disperses the misplaced otoliths and permits desensitization to the feeling of vertigo.
